1972-19 Removing Designation of Burrow Site for Portions of Bells Flats Subdivisioni KODIAK ISLAND BOROUGH ORDINANCE NUMBER 72 -19 -0 I I AN ORDINANCE OF THE BOROUGH ASSEMBLY OF THE KODIAK ISLAND BOROUGH REMOVING THE DESIGNATION OF BURROW SITE FROM i' TWO PORTIONS OF TRACT "A" BELLS FLATS ALASKA SUBDIVISION. WHEREAS, AS 07.15.340 empowers the Borough to enact - a zoning ordinance and provide for its administration, enforcement and amendment, and WHEREAS, the Kodiak Island Borough has pursuant thereto, adopted Chapter 5 of its Code of Ordinances and Resolutions, which provides for planning and zoning provisions and procedures, and WHEREAS, according to the Comprehensive Planning and Zoning Map adopted by the Kodiak Island Borough, as amended by Ordinance No. 69 -30 -0, Tracts "A" and "B" of the Bells Flats Alaska Subdivision were designated burrow sites and zoned "Industrial ", and WHEREAS, a portion of Tract "A" leased to ROYAL LARGE in November, 1971, is designated as a burrow site, but cannot be used as such because the irregular shape would make it impossible to meet the slope grades and other restrictions placed on it by the Burrow Site Ordinance, and WHEREAS, another portion of Tract "A" was deeded to the State of Alaska for construction of a slaughter house to be operated by the Kodiak Stock Growers Association, and is being used as such, and therefore, although an industrial use should not be classified as a burrow site, and the Kodiak Island Planning and Zoning Commission at its meeting of June 21, 1972 having recommended to the Borough Assembly the redesignation of these two tracts, and it appearing to the Assembly that the public necessity, convenience, general welfare and good zoning practice requires that these tracts be redesignated.
